I recently got a great deal on TG and purchased a 51# 60" DA. The grip is just a bit narrower at the throat than the Signature elite takedown that I have, but I really like that and wish the takedown had this grip. The workmanship is excellent and the bow shoots well. Surprisingly to me, it is not all that heavy, but still quite calm in the hand when shot. The deadness at the shot is there but the weight doe's not seem to be substantially heavier than most woods.
For me so far it really performs well, but I wish the draw weight was lighter, I really am not used to much more than 45 or so and I draw about 54# out of this one. I think you won't be dissapointed if you get one.
